Vidal/Wettenstein and DVB Realty co-broker $1.55 million sale

The building and land at 16 Fitch St., Norwalk Connecticut has been sold. It had been formerly occupied by the Harco Fitch Company. The building is a 24,000 s/f 2-story brick building situated on three quarters of an acre. The sales price was $1.55 million or $64,58 per s/f. The purchaser, SalesOne, LLC, presently located in Norwalk, will expand into the facility once it has been modified to suit their needs. Salesone is a manufacturer and wholesaler of jewelry and accessories, with a main focus being body and stainless steel jewelry. Bruce Wettenstein, SIOR of Vidal/Wettenstein represented Salesone, LLC. John Zervos and Bob Virgulak of DVB Realty were the listing brokers. Counsel for the seller was Fiore & Fiore of Norwalk, and counsel for the purchaser was Jonathan Wells.
